Common Issues & Solutions
Issue: pip install fails with SSL errors
Solution:
pip install --trusted-host pypi.org --trusted-host pypi.python.org --trusted-host files.pythonhosted.org -r backend/requirements.txt
Issue: npm install fails with permission errors
Solution:
# Don't use sudo! Fix npm permissions instead: mkdir ~/.npm-global npm config set prefix '~/.npm-global' export PATH=~/.npm-global/bin:$PATH # Then retry npm install
Issue: Database file won't create
Solution:
# Ensure project root is writable cd /Users/franklindickinson/Projects/budget-buddy-2 touch test.txt && rm test.txt # Test write permissions # Create manually with SQLite sqlite3 budget_buddy.db "VACUUM;"
Issue: Backend can't import modules
Solution:
# Ensure virtual environment is activated source .venv/bin/activate # Verify Python is from venv which python # Should show: /Users/franklindickinson/Projects/budget-buddy-2/.venv/bin/python # Re-install dependencies pip install -r backend/requirements.txt

Issue: Port 3000 or 8000 already in use
Solution:
# Kill process on port 8000 pkill -f "uvicorn.*8000" # Kill process on port 3000 pkill -f "node.*3000"
